Viscosity index improvers are essential additives in modern lubricants, especially for applications exposed to varying temperatures. These polymers enhance the lubricant's ability to maintain optimal viscosity across a broad temperature range. By preventing the oil from thinning too much at high temperatures or thickening excessively at low temperatures, viscosity index improvers ensure consistent engine and machinery performance.

One of the major benefits of using viscosity index improvers in lubricants is improved fuel efficiency. With stable oil viscosity, engines experience less friction and wear, leading to smoother operation and lower energy consumption. This also extends the life of mechanical parts, reducing maintenance costs over time.

Another advantage is enhanced protection during cold starts. In low temperatures, lubricants with viscosity index improvers flow more easily, ensuring vital engine parts are quickly coated and protected.

Industries using heavy-duty machinery and automotive engines particularly benefit from these additives. Whether you're a manufacturer or end-user, understanding the role of viscosity index improvers can help in selecting the right lubricant additives for improved performance and durability.
